Zachari Logan is a Canadian visual artist creating very intense and meticulous drawings that grab everyone’s attention. In recent work, the artist explores his body as a queer embodiment of nature. These pieces evolve a visual language which speaks to the metaphoric as well as the metaphysical. Read more
Stefan Zsaitsits is an Australian artist creating black and white drawings of quirky characters from children’s tales and his imagination. His drawings are surrealistic and very intriguing. The people and their story emerge during the process of drawing and have many storylines. Read more
Christine Ödlund is an artist and composer who lives and works in Stockholm, Sweden. She creates art in a very unique way, composing organic visual interpretations of her mind. Christine explores unknown phenomena of the natural world, illustrating fictitious sound waves conceived by her. Read more
